Super Eagles stars Alex Iwobi and Calvin Bassey were both in action as Fulham defeated Tottenham Hotspur 2-0 at Craven Cottage on Sunday in the English Premier League.

Two late goals by Rodrigo Muniz and Ryan Sessegnon secured all three points for Fulham.

Both sides were at each other's throats from the start, with numerous chances created, but the first half ended goalless despite the intense pressure.

Iwobi was instrumental in most of Fulham’s positive moves throughout the game.

The home side deservedly took the lead in the 78th minute, thanks to an assist from Andreas Pereira.

Tottenham pushed forward in search of an equalizer but were caught out when Sessegnon scored Fulham’s second goal, effectively sealing the victory for the home side.

Iwobi and Bassey numbers in Fulham's impressive win over Tottenham

Both players started the game, but Iwobi was substituted in the 63rd minute, while Bassey played the full match.

Iwobi had 47 touches and completed 19 of his 28 attempted passes, registering a 68% success rate. He delivered one successful cross out of four attempts and completed one of two long balls.

The 28-year-old attempted four dribbles, succeeding in two. In duels, he lost his only aerial contest and won five of the 11 ground duels he engaged in.

Bassey played a key role in Fulham’s clean sheet with his defensive contributions. He made four tackles and recorded three clearances.

The defender had 53 touches and completed 39 of his 43 attempted passes, achieving a 91% success rate.

He won one of three aerial duels and was more effective on the ground, winning six of the eight ground duels he contested.
